So just to doublecheck:

1) You are using your website name as the host right? So in your case: home-biz-success.net

2) You've made sure you don't have any extra spaces around your username and password (the copy function leaves one extra space at the end of your username so double-check it)

3) Filezilla comes up with a warning for me about allowing my connection through my firewall. Does that come up for you or no? Try disabling your firewall temporarily to see if that let's you through.

And if all that fails:

4) It's been noted that you have to change the settings of your FTP from passive to active. I didn't have to but here's how to do it: Go to "edit" and click "settings". Then click on "FTP" and choose the transfer mode to be active instead of the default which is passive. Then click OK and you should be good to go hopefully.

Since you're getting connected, you don't seem to have any issues with your site address, username, or password. I suspect that switching the transfers from passive to active (as Thischick mentioned) may be the key to getting the transfers working.

Which hosting company are you with? Have you tried using your company's FTP through their cPanel? That should work if nothing else does.
